How it feels

The film tells the true story of a woman with mental illness who died alone in an abandoned New Hampshire farmhouse. Her diary entries and drawings are used to reconstruct her final months.

What happens

God Knows Where I Am is a 2016 American documentary film directed and produced by Todd Wider and Jedd Wider and narrated by Lori Singer. The film premiered to critical acclaim, and screened in cities and film festivals all over the world, winning numerous awards, including the Special Jury Prize for International Feature at Hot Docs Canadian International Documentary Festival. The documentary premiered on PBS stations in USA, on October 15, 2018. (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
